Vertigo to add casino to Columbia park
BY Tom Walker



Vertigo Theme Parks (VTP), the operator of the Vertigo Theme Park in Buga, Colombia, has announced that it will open a casino at the site.

The 150,000sq ft casino will be one of the first to be located within the gates of a theme park anywhere around the world, and will include high-stake, Las Vegas style gaming tables as well as slot and gaming machines.

Kevin Johnson, chief executive of VTP, said the casino will be managed by an external operator under a facility management agreement.

He said: "The casino will operate within the Free Zone territory of the park and with a special governmental decree it will enjoy advantageous taxation status, which will allow the overall operation of the Buga Theme Park to become even more profitable."

VTP, which has its head offices in Boca Raton, Florida, US, currently only operates the Buga site but plans to roll out its theme park concept across the globe.

It has plans to open seven new Vertigo-branded parks in seven years.
